Following on from the success of Green Inc and with the same bold, provocative and entirely un-switchoffable energy, writer, comedian and satirist Heydon Prowse turns his tongue-in-cheek attention corporate Wokewashing.
From a razor company talking about #MeToo to an LGBT sandwich and a burger chain tackling depression, writer and satirist Heydon Prowse unpacks how some of the world's biggest corporations are falling over themselves to appear socially conscious, progressive. And he lifts the lid on the advertising and PR companies who've woken up to just how much money they can make helping them.
In this first episode, Pride Before a Fall?, Heydon investigates corporations’ approach to LGBTQ+ inclusivity. He’ll trace the history from brands’ first engagements with gay customers to the situation today, where Pride month sees the high street and social media festooned with corporate rainbow flags. Heydon will ask how many companies live up to this inclusive message in actions. This episode will also take a look at the backlash to brand engagement with LGBTQ+ issues that has been seen in the UK and the USA as the corporate world is drawn into the culture wars. It’s led to boycotts and hasty backpedalling, but what’s really going on, and why?
